Grade A, and why
research scanned grade A with 0 findings against 26 rules in 11 categories — prompt injection, anti-refusal, data exfiltration, privilege escalation, supply chain, agent snooping, system-prompt leakage, SSRF and excessive agency — measured 4d ago.
A static scan of the body, not an audit. Every finding is printed with the line that produced it so you can judge whether it matters here. A mod is markdown that instructs an agent; that is exactly why what it instructs is worth reading.
Nothing flagged
None of the 26 patterns this scan looks for appear in this file: no shell pipes, no recursive deletes, no credential paths, no hidden text, no instruction-override or anti-refusal phrasing, no agent-config snooping. That is not a guarantee, it is the absence of the things that are checkable.

research — external knowledge → §R
Every finding cites a source. No source → flag it ?, never write a guess as fact.
"Process without library context gives you well-organized hallucinations." Build invents a plausible-but-wrong API & §B fills with avoidable bugs. Research is the external oracle: pull the real fact once, log it caveman, never re-derive.
WHEN TO RESEARCH
- A §C/§I/§V decision hinges on a lib, API, version, or pattern you are unsure of.
- You are about to assume how an external dependency behaves.
- The idea touches a domain with real prior art (auth, payments, crypto, rate-limit).
/grillparked a?that the outside world must answer.
Skip when the build touches only code you already wrote. Research scales to the unknown, ⊥ to habit.
FOUR STEPS
1. SCOPE
Turn the unknown into 1-3 concrete questions. Vague "research auth" → "JWT lib for Node ESM, maintained?" + "refresh-token rotation: current best practice?". A scoped question gets a citable answer; a vague one gets an essay.
2. GATHER
Use web search / docs tools. Prefer primary sources: official docs, the repo, the RFC, the paper. Two independent sources beat one confident blog. For a big sweep, spawn a sub-agent so the raw pages never touch this context — it returns only the distilled finding + source.
3. DISTILL
Crush each answer to one caveman line + its source. Drop the prose. The §R row is the memory; the tab you read is not.
R3|refresh token|rotate on use, revoke family on reuse-detect|datatracker.ietf.org/doc/html/rfc6819#section-5.2.2.3
4. HAND OFF
Emit the §R rows & hand to the spec skill to append. If a finding changes a constraint or interface, note the §C/§I edit for spec too. Research proposes; spec writes.
SOURCE DISCIPLINE
- Cite a URL, repo, RFC, or paper per row. Verbatim identifiers/versions.
- Could not verify → write the row but flag
?in the finding & say so. An unverified claim labeled honestly is fine; one disguised as fact is a future §B. - Conflicting sources → log both, let the user pick. ⊥ silently average them.
